Marketing Coordinator Interview Guide



Problem Solving ----> Weight: ____% Rating: ___
IDENTIFY and DEFINE problem causing factors
COLLECT and ANALYZE pertinent INFORMATION
DEVELOP and EVALUATE possible solutions
DETERMINE the IMPACT of proposed solutions
IMPLEMENT problem solving decisions and FOLLOW-UP on results

Interview Question

Probing Questions (if needed)

What you’re looking for

Describe a time when you felt it was necessary to significantly modify or change a marketing plan because of an unforeseen problem.

Why was change needed?
What was changed?
What was the result?

Clarity of thought process.
Good results.

Tell me about a time when you felt especially innovative in solving a marketing problem.

Why was this innovative?
What was the result?

How innovative was this?
Good results?

Explain an especially difficult marketing problem you have had to resolve and how you handled it.

Why was the problem difficult?
What was the result?

How creative was the approach? Good results?

Describe a time when you had to convince others that your proposed solution to a marketing problem was the best one?

Who did you have to convince?
What was the result?
What would you do differently in a similar future situation?

Proper tact and diplomacy.
Flexibility regarding future situations.

Tell me about a time when you felt that it was necessary to abolish a current marketing plan.

Why was change needed?
What was the result?

Ability to recognize when something isn’t working and take the proper action.

Considering your current (or last) job, to whom do you turn for assistance in resolving work problems?

Do you sometimes turn to others as well?

Ability to get the right information to get the job done quickly.

Verbal Communications ----> Weight: ____% Rating: ___
Use appropriate GRAMMAR and VOCABULARY
Express OPINIONS or INTERESTS tactfully
Respond CLEARLY and DIRECTLY
Use appropriate VOICE TONE

Interview Question

Probing Questions (if needed)

What you’re looking for

Please describe the most significant marketing presentation you have ever made.

Why was it significant and what was the result?
Is there anything you would do differently if faced with the same challenges in the future?

How significant was this?
Success in results.
Flexibility for future situations.

Describe the last time you had to make a presentation to attendees at an industry conference and how you tailored the presentation to meet the needs of that group.

What adaptations did you make for this group in particular?
What was the result?

Ability to recognize when adaptation is necessary and take proper action.
Good results.

Tell me about a time when you had to communicate with another person even when that individual disliked you or wasn’t interested in communicating.

Why was this person difficult to deal with?
What considerations went into determining your final approach?
What was the result?

Good insight in dealing with difficult situations.

Proper results.

Tell me about the last time that you had to communicate negative information to a supervisor?

Why was the information negative?
What was the reaction?

Proper tack and diplomacy.
Proper grasp of anticipated reactions of the other person.

 

 (Is his/her grammar & vocabulary appropriate for the work; responses clear and direct?).

(Is the applicant expressing his/her thoughts clearly and convincingly?).

Written Communications ----> Weight: ____% Rating: ___
Demonstrate proper use and understanding of WORK PLACE TERMINOLOGY
Use correct GRAMMAR, PUNCTUATION and SPELLING
EXPRESS IDEAS, CONCERNS and ISSUES effectively

Interview Question

Probing Questions (if needed)

What you’re looking for

Give me some examples of firm brochures you have developed?

Were these independently developed or did you have assistance?
Can you provide samples if needed?

Degree of independence.
Quality of work.

Give me some examples of direct mail promotions you have developed?

Were these independently developed or did you have assistance?
Can you provide samples if needed?
How large was the mailing list?
How did you go about targeting the recipients?

Degree of independence.
Effective selection of target audience.
Quality of work.

Tell me about your most successful direct mail promotion.

Why do you think this one was especially successful?
How large was the mailing list?

Degree of success.
Significance of size.

Tell me about your least successful direct mail promotion.

Why do you think this one was especially unsuccessful?
How large was the mailing list?
How would you avoid a similar situation in the future?

Ability to recognize and face failure.

Describe your philosophy and experience in general advertising.

Where is it good (not good) to do general advertising?

Solid grasp of where to best spend general advertising dollars.

Describe your experience in writing and issuing press releases.

What steps do you take to assure that a press release is accepted and distributed?
Can you provide samples of your press releases?

Good savvy regarding how to get press recognition.

Tell me about any magazine articles you have written and gotten published.

Can you provide samples?
What did you do to enhance the odds of making it to publication?

Good savvy regarding how to get magazine articles published.

Interpersonal Relations ----> Weight: ____% Rating: ___
Recognize STRENGTHS and WEAKNESSES in working relationships
Practice appropriate social PROTOCOL
COOPERATE with coworkers
Accept or communicate CONSTRUCTIVE CRITICISM sensitively

Interview Question

Probing Questions (if needed)

What you’re looking for

Describe a time when you were the receiver of a complaint from another department within your company concerning the services of your department.

What was the resolution?

Ability to resolve internal squabbles.

Tell me about a time when you experienced a significant change in your work environment.

What were your feelings and what did you do to adapt?

 

Ability to adapt to change.

Describe a time when you were involved in an ineffective teamwork situation.

What actions did you take to improve the situation?
What was the result?

Ability to recognize ineffective teamwork and willingness to take proper action to get on track.

Tell me about a time when you took the lead in a teamwork situation even though there was no official leader.

Were you immediately accepted in this role or was there some resistance from other teammates?

Proper tact and diplomacy with drive to get the job done.

Tell me how you react to criticism? Tell me about the last time that you received criticism.

Did you think the criticism was warranted?

Recognition of the value of appropriate criticism and proper acceptance of it.

Tell me about a time when you had a problem getting along with a coworker?

What was the result?

Ability to remain cool headed and take proper steps for resolution of conflict.

Tell me about a time when you had a problem getting along with a supervisor?

What was the result?

Ability to remain cool headed and take proper steps for resolution of conflict.

Decision Making ----> Weight: ____% Rating: ___
LOCATE and PROCESS information from a variety of sources
ORGANIZE and ANALYZE information
Grasp important and ignore irrelevant information
OVERCOME FEAR of making wrong decisions
RECOGNIZE RELATIONSHIPS between standards, policies, regulations

Interview Question

Probing Questions (if needed)

What you’re looking for

Tell me about a time when you had to identify who the client’s key decision makers were.

What went into your analysis?

 

Describe one of the most difficult work decisions you have had to make and describe how you went about deciding it.

What was the result?

Proper approach to difficult decisions.

How thoroughly do you gather & analyze facts before making a decision?

Ask for supporting examples from past employment

Proper balance of thoroughness and ability to get the job done in a timely fashion.

Tell me how you feel about making a decision that could be wrong?

Everyone makes mistakes. What was your last “wrong” decision and what did you do about it?

Understanding of risk management in decision-making.

Tell about a time when you made a decision prematurely..... before the necessary information was attained and analyzed.

Get the specifics.

Ability to recognize errors in judgment and admit to them.

Describe a time when you had to make a decision when relevant information was limited or incomplete.

Get the specifics.

Ability to move ahead after considering proper risk.
